Girls outshine boys as JKBOSE declares Class 10th Jammu division results

Srinagar, Apr 21: Jammu and Kashmir Board of School Education on Tuesday declared the Class 10th Annual Regular Examination results for the March-April 2026 session of Jammu Division, with 88% pass percentage, while girls outperforming boys in the overall performance.

As per the official data, the overall pass percentage has been recorded at 88.85 percent, with a total of 50,754 students appearing in the examination. Out of these, 45,094 students qualified successfully.

The results highlight a better performance by girls, who achieved a pass percentage of 90.42 percent, while boys recorded 87.51 percent, continuing the trend of female candidates leading in academic outcomes.

Officials said the strong performance reflects improved academic standards and consistent efforts by students and institutions across the Jammu division. (KNC)
